eth算法叫什么(eth用的什么算法)
以太坊是一种基于区块链技术的去中心化应用平台,其共识算法是实现区块链网络共识的重要组成部分以太坊采用了称为“工作量证明”ProofofWork,PoW的共识算法来验证交易和添加新的区块到链上在以太坊中,挖矿节点使用计算能力来解决数学难题,这些数学难题需要大量计算资源来解决完成解题的矿工将;以太坊采用的是Ethash加密算法,在挖矿的过程中,需要读取内存并存储DAG文件由于每一次读取内存的带宽都是有限的,而现有的计算机技术又很难在这个问题上有质的突破,所以无论如何提高计算机的运算效率,内存读取效率仍然不会有很大的改观因此从某种意义上来说,以太坊的Ethash加密算法具有“抗ASIC性”。
这个算法是计算密集型算法,一开始从CPU挖矿,转而为GPU,转而为FPGA,转而为ASIC,从而使得算力变得非常集中算力集中就会带来一个问题,若有一个矿池的算力达到51%,则它就会有作恶的风险这是比特币等使用工作量证明算法的系统的弊端而以太坊则吸取了这个教训,进行了一些改进,诞生了Ethash算法。
eth用的什么算法
以太坊采用的是工作量证明ProofofWork的算法,即ETHash与比特币挖矿的SHA256算法不同,ETHash算法是基于DAG图形的计算DAG图是一种有向无环图,由以太坊初始块生成,每个新的区块都基于前一个区块的DAG进行计算因此,简单地说,以太坊挖矿需要解决DAG图形的计算问题具体来说,以太坊的挖矿。
PoS算法是以太坊中用来验证交易的核心技术,它与传统的PoW算法不同,PoW算法需要通过计算来验证交易,这样一来计算能力越强的矿工获得新币的几率就越大,来保证区块链的稳定性而PoS算法则是利用代币的持有量来获得验证交易的权利,这样一来就减少了交易验证的时间以及能源的浪费此外,以太坊还通过合约。
以太坊Ethereum是一种去中心化的开源区块链平台,PoS是指权益认证Proof of Stake这种共识算法PoS机制与之前比特币的PoWProof of Work机制不同,它使用抵押来验证区块提交,验证节点不再需要通过算力来获得记账权,而是通过持有一定数量的代币,例如ETH,来获得权益证明,这样可以减少需要耗费。
eth和etc算法
1、这节课介绍的是以太坊非常核心的挖矿算法 在介绍Ethash算法之前,先讲一些背景知识其实区块链技术主要是解决一个共识的问题,而共识是一个层次很丰富的概念,这里把范畴缩小,只讨论区块链中的共识 什么是共识? 在区块链中,共识是指哪个节点有记账权网络中有多个节点,理论上都有记账权,首先面临的问题就是。
2、以太坊采用的是Ethash 加密算法,在挖矿的过程中,需要读取内存并存储 DAG 文件由于每一次读取内寸的带宽都是有限的,而现有的计算机技术又很难在这个问题上有质的突破,所以无论如何提高计算机的运算效率,内存读取效率仍然不会有很大的改观因此,从某种意义上来说,以太坊的Ethash加密算法具有“抗ASI。
3、首先,比特币主要是一种加密货币,而以太坊则是一款平台,可以实现去中心化应用程序和智能合约其次,以太坊使用的目标算法与比特币不同,这意味着它可以处理更多的任务最后,以太坊的交易速度更快,交易费用更低结论以太坊是一个非常有前途的区块链技术,它提供了许多新的功能和用途如果您有兴趣。
评论